1 On Tue, 26 Jan 2010 16:56:12 -0200, luis jure wrote:
2
3 > >ATTRS{idVendor}=="1410", ATTRS{idProduct}=="5010",
4 > >ACTION=="add",RUN+="/usr/bin/eject %k"
5 > >
6 > >was the line I used to prevent one such modem showing up as a CD.
7 >
8 > thanks for your answer, but i take it that this only hides the
9 > partition? any ideas how i can effectively delete it?
10
11 You can't if it is in the drive's firmware. It's not a physical partition
12 if repartitioning the drive doesn't touch it. "ejecting" the CD means it
13 is no longer present, that's why the device disappears.
